PURE is hiring a Senior Service Enablement Analyst

About the Role

PURE is hiring a Senior Service Enablement Analyst to empower our Service teams with the tools and strategies needed to deliver an exceptional live service experience. In this role, you will partner with leaders across Member Services, Broker Services, and Member Advocates to implement and optimize new technologies and best practices.

What You'll Do

  • Develop and execute strategies to scale new technologies across Service, partnering with Service leaders to ensure adoption and maximize impact.
  • Continue to build out AI-enabled live service capabilities through Cresta, optimizing existing tools and expanding capabilities.
  • Deliver insights on adoption and usage of emerging technology tools, service interaction trends, and call quality wins and opportunities.
  • Develop rules-based guidance for live service interactions through Cresta and other tools.
  • Oversee execution of member and broker chat, including staffing, reporting and analysis, change management, and process design.
  • Lead projects to improve our ability to expertly and efficiently serve members and brokers in their channel of choice.

PURE

PURE Insurance is a property and casualty insurance company—think homes, cars, fine art and collections—designed exclusively for financially successful individuals and families. We're dedicated to delivering an exceptional experience to our members by alleviating stress, solving challenges and removing conflict, wherever possible, from the insurance process.
